Great-granddaughter of Lampião and Maria Bonita, Gleuse Ferreira designed a space that celebrates the influence of her ancestors in various sectors of Brazilian culture, such as art, fashion, cinema and architecture. In the 107 m² circulation area, the professional proudly relives the history of the cangaceiro couple through wallpaper illustrated by designer Jade Marangolo. The terracotta cement tiles were chosen for the flooring because they are reminiscent of the Northeastern soil. The furniture is designed by Jader Almeida.
